    Choosing the Right Specialist for Eyebrow Transplantation in Halifax

    When considering eyebrow transplantation in Halifax, selecting the right specialist is crucial for achieving natural-looking and long-lasting results. This procedure, also known as eyebrow restoration, involves the meticulous transfer of hair follicles from one part of the body to the eyebrow area. Here are some key factors to consider when choosing a doctor for this delicate procedure.

    Expertise and Experience

    The first and foremost consideration should be the doctor's expertise and experience in eyebrow transplantation. Look for a specialist who has a proven track record in performing successful eyebrow transplants. Experience in handling various hair types and skin conditions can significantly influence the outcome of the procedure. A doctor with extensive experience will be better equipped to address any complications that may arise during or after the surgery.

    Specialized Training and Certifications

    Ensure that the doctor you choose has undergone specialized training in hair transplantation and holds relevant certifications. Membership in professional organizations such as the International Society of Hair Restoration Surgery (ISHRS) can be an indicator of a doctor's commitment to staying updated with the latest techniques and best practices in the field.

    Patient Reviews and Testimonials

    Reading patient reviews and testimonials can provide valuable insights into the doctor's practice. Look for feedback on the doctor's bedside manner, the thoroughness of the consultation process, and the overall satisfaction with the results. Positive reviews from previous patients can help build confidence in your choice.

    Comprehensive Consultation Process

    A thorough consultation is essential to understand your specific needs and expectations. A good doctor will take the time to assess your hair and skin type, discuss your goals, and explain the entire procedure in detail. This includes the potential risks, recovery process, and expected outcomes. A comprehensive consultation ensures that you are well-informed and comfortable with the decision to proceed with the transplant.

    State-of-the-Art Facilities

    The quality of the medical facility where the procedure will be performed is another important factor. Ensure that the clinic is equipped with state-of-the-art technology and follows strict hygiene and safety protocols. A well-maintained facility with modern equipment can contribute to a smoother and safer procedure.

    Personalized Treatment Plan

    Every individual has unique hair characteristics and aesthetic goals. A reputable doctor will create a personalized treatment plan tailored to your specific needs. This includes the selection of donor hair, the technique used for transplantation, and the post-operative care plan. A personalized approach ensures that the results are natural-looking and aligned with your expectations.

    In conclusion, choosing the right doctor for eyebrow transplantation in Halifax involves careful consideration of their expertise, specialized training, patient feedback, consultation process, facility quality, and the ability to provide a personalized treatment plan. By taking these factors into account, you can make an informed decision and achieve the best possible results for your eyebrow restoration.
